North Dakota Code 23-09.4-08 – Penalty
1. Any person who operates or manages a residential care facility for children with autism spectrum disorder without first obtaining a license as required by this chapter is guilty of a class B misdemeanor.
Attorney's Note
Under the North Dakota Code, punishments for crimes depend on the classification. In the case of this section:Class | Prison | Fine |
---|---|---|
Class B misdemeanor | up to 30 days | up to $1,500 |

2. Any person who violates any provision of this chapter or any rule adopted under this chapter may be assessed a civil penalty not to exceed one thousand dollars for each violation and for each day the violation continues, plus interest and any costs incurred by the department to enforce this penalty. The civil penalty may be imposed by a court in a civil proceeding or by the department through an administrative hearing under chapter 28-32. The assessment of a civil penalty does not preclude the imposition of other sanctions authorized by rules adopted under this chapter.
